Rittenberg Manor is my home now for 4.5 yrs. It is a senior building and the age requirement is 62.The building is about 7 yrs old so its relatively new. We have both an excellent overall manager and building maintenance manager who do a great job !! There are 99 apartments on 4 floors. Apartments are mostly single bedroom and some two bedrooms with some size differences.All bedrooms have a double door closet 57\" by 28\", with an overhead light and shelf above the pole to hanger your clothes on. Each apt has a kitchen with electric stove with an over-stove exhaust fan, light and fire extinguisher, refrigerator/freezer and dishwasher.The kitchen also has ample wooden cabinetry and a coat closet and shelved food closet and linoyan floors. All apartments have a palor with a sliding glass double door that leads to your balcony with an overhead roof. Bathrooms may differ slightly but are relatively spacious with a shelved closet, medicine cabinet, exhaust fan, plenty of lighting, toilet and mine has a bathtub with an adjustable shower, tile floor and \"handicap rails\" in several places should I need them. I dont know if that is true throughout. Between the bedroom and bathroom I have a walk-in 4 by 45\" storage space with an overhead light and a light-weight shelf. Beige carpet throughout the apartment where there is no tile or linoleum. Two separate laundry rooms 2nd & 4th floors 4 washers, 4 dryers each and your credit/debit/ebt. Everything is clean and functional and well maintained. The first floor has the only coin/paper money machine in the building. The first floor has most community areas: mail room for everyone , the office managers where you sign up, the maintenance manager office available 9 to 5 and in emergencies you can call as he lives on sight. There is a computer room with 4 computers. There is a hair stylist/barber. The Comunity Room or bingo room or party room where we have parties on winter holidays with a kitchen,refrigerator, sink, a good size counter, dishwasher, 6 tables with 4 chairs each with wood floors. Adjoining this openspaced Community Room is a carpeted area with a Couch and a couple of chairs and a 4 or 5 foot screen TV, books & media. Across the hall from the Community Room is a smaller Multi-Purpose room maximum capacity of 41. This room also has a sink counters, wooden cabinetry and library with puzzles, games and books. Both rooms residents frequent playing cards, dominoes and a couple other games if that thrills you. If you want to exercise we have a gym with a 24\"TV to watch while you work out on 4 fairly expensive electronically equipped machines guaranteed to keep you buff if you dare !! Outside we have a Gazebo about 12 foot across. No smoking is allowed anywhere inside the building. Outside the 8 sliding glass doors of the front entrance is a cement porch with rocking chairs in the nice weather. The back entrance opens up to the parking lot... probably 35 or 40 cars. You can also park in front. Our Building and Gazebo take up a city block. There are cameras inside and outside almost everywhere running 24/7 and they come in handy. Contractors are hired to power wash the building, the lawn is cut, shrubbery trimmed, leave blowers and snow is plowed and walkways shoveled.Hallways are also vacumed. There are two elevators located near the center of the building and concrete stair ways on the both far ends to all 4 floors that you can also enter/exit with the only one electric key each resident is given which works on all entrances. Its nice to have a car living here but major stores are 5, 10, 15 or more minutes away. But locally a half mile walk gets you to our small 2 light town with a great Pizzeria Italian restaurant, mid-size grocery store with an excellent delicatessen, Wawa, Walgreens, Autozone, Harbor Dinner and more. Its safe to walk outside and we are in a small old town in the middle of farm country. I enjoy my life living here.
